How do you make a bathroom towel shelf?

Making a bathroom towel shelf is a straightforward project that can provide a stylish and practical way to store towels. Here are the steps you’ll need to take:

1. Gather Materials: Start by measuring the space where the shelf should be installed, bearing in mind the height, width, and depth you will need for your particular shelf. Next, purchase the wood, screws, and towel bar that you need for the shelf.

You can find all these items at a local hardware store.

2. Cut the Wood: Using the measurements from step one, cut the wood to size using either a saw or a chop saw. Make sure all your cuts are precise so that the shelf will fit correctly and look good.

3. Install the Mounting Board: After you’ve cut the wood, position the mounting board on the wall where you plan to hang the shelf. Secure the board with screws, then use a level to make sure it’s straight.

4. Attach the Shelf Boards: Place the shelf boards onto the mounting board, securing them with screws. Add the towel bar to the boards if desired.

Your bathroom towel shelf is now ready to use! This is a quick and easy project that can be done in an afternoon and will help you better organize your towels.

What can I use instead of a towel bar?

If you don’t want to use a towel bar, there are plenty of other options for storing and drying towels. You could opt for a hanging basket, as this provides easy access without taking up too much visual space.

You could also go for a ladder-style towel rack, which not only provides space to dry your linens, but also adds a unique visual element to your bathroom. Wall-mounted shelves are another option — they create storage space while providing a place to hang multiple towels at once.

Over-the-door towel racks are great for renters and people with small bathrooms, as they provide extra storage without taking up any floor or wall space. Additionally, a free-standing towel rack or valet can be an attractive storage solution that also adds style to your bathroom.

Finally, you could simply mount your towels on hooks; this is an economical option that provides easy access while also leaving room to hang other bath products.

What is the height for towel hooks?

The height for towel hooks is a matter of personal preference and can depend on a variety of factors, such as the height of the user, the type of towel being hung, as well as the amount of space available in the bathroom.

Generally, towel hooks are hung at a height between 48 and 54 inches above the floor — the majority of people are comfortable reaching up to grab a towel at this range. Some may even prefer to hang their towel a bit lower, ranging between 36 and 48 inches.

It’s always best to install a few sample hooks at varying heights and measure the reach of potential users before deciding on the final height.
